Ambitious Aston Martin eager to build on last year F1 promise
Despite a downturn in performance during the 2023 season, the team’s impressive start offers optimism that their investments will eventually yield positive results.
The sight of Fernando Alonso radiating joy marked the beginning of the 2023 Formula One season, with his Aston Martin team achieving a stunning victory at the season opener in Bahrain. Alonso secured a podium finish, and Aston Martin unexpectedly found themselves among the top contenders in F1. This was a significant turnaround from their seventh-place finish in 2022, where they struggled at the back of the field. The Sakhir circuit showcased Aston Martin’s transformative form, with Alonso comfortably outperforming both Mercedes and Ferrari. This successful start was not a fleeting moment, as Aston Martin maintained momentum, with Alonso claiming six podiums in the first eight races.

While the season ultimately concluded with a fifth-place finish, falling behind Mercedes, Ferrari, and a surging McLaren, it is viewed as a stepping stone for a promising 2024. The team, led by Alonso and Team Principal Mike Krack, remains optimistic and aims to break into the forefront of F1 competition.
Alonso, despite the lackluster end, labeled 2023 as a success, acknowledging the hard work that lies ahead. Krack shares this sentiment, emphasizing the need to take the next steps in the team’s development. Looking ahead, Aston Martin faces the challenge of finding innovative solutions and being creative in their pursuit of success.

Team principal Mike Krack, known for his calm and measured approach, expresses confidence in the team’s future. He emphasizes the difficulty of progressing beyond initial steps but believes in the team’s increasing ability to meet ambitious goals. The team’s aspirations are genuine, supported by billionaire owner Lawrence Stroll’s passion and significant investments.

Aston Martin’s future success is closely tied to the substantial investments made by Stroll. These include a new factory complex at Silverstone and a state-of-the-art wind tunnel facility. The factory, operational since last year, will reach full potential this season when the wind tunnel also becomes active. Additionally, a strategic deal with Honda, set to be the team’s works engine supplier in 2026, is in place. Stroll’s financial backing enabled the signing of Alonso and the recruitment of experienced technical director Dan Fallows from Red Bull, highlighting a considerable personnel expansion. These investments form the core of the team’s approach, characterized by Krack as “people, tools, and process,” with the latter requiring experience and intense competition to fully materialize.
